Transaction 058da2c930a5812862830f02a3870cf569696969b86cb71d0afb60d8677ea1b7

2 Input
1 Outputs
  • 058da2c930a5812862830f02a3870cf569696969b86cb71d0afb60d8677ea1b7:0
  • value  955824
    address  2MxAcfRUhA26ap2pBop9ETgTj231eXw8vJ9